Today, already many applications provide Text-to-Speech (TTS) technology. It allows users with or without disabilities to receive information more easily and frees the visual sense for other tasks. This technology provides new level of interaction between the applications and the users, allowing users to consume information via the auditory senses. Lately the Text-to-Speech (TTS) technology is becoming more available via mobile, WEB and desktop applications.
